At-home end-tidal carbon dioxide measurement in children with invasive home mechanical ventilation.

Carolyn C FosterSoyang KwonAvani V ShahCaroline A HodgsonLindsey P Hird-McCorryAngela JanusAneta M JedraszkoPhilip SwansonMatthew M DavisDenise M GoodmanTheresa A Laguna
Published in: Pediatric pulmonology (2022)
A portable, noninvasive device for measuring EtCO<sub>2</sub> was feasible and acceptable, with values that trend similarly to currently in-practice, outpatient models. These devices may facilitate monitoring of EtCO<sub>2</sub> at home in children with invasive HMV.
